ChatGPT projects XRP could reach $6-8 by December 2026 if global exchange-traded funds absorb $10 billion in institutional demand. The AI model calculates $9 billion in additional buying pressure would remove 4.1 billion tokens—7.2% of circulating supply—from worldwide markets.
Without ETF participation, the model forecasts XRP at $4.40 by Q1 2026. The analysis mirrors institutional AI adoption seen across financial centers: JPMorgan and Goldman Sachs disclosed natural language processing deployments for market analysis in 2025, while Asian banks from HSBC to DBS have rolled out similar systems.
The $10 billion scenario draws on precedent from Bitcoin and Ethereum spot ETF launches in U.S. markets during 2024. Those products attracted $4.6 billion and $2.8 billion respectively in opening quarters, establishing baseline institutional adoption rates now being tested globally.
Ripple's 2023 partial legal victory against the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ission created the regulatory clarity condition ChatGPT identifies as necessary. Similar frameworks are emerging internationally: the EU's Markets in Crypto-Assets regulation took effect in 2024, while Singapore and Hong Kong updated digital asset guidelines in 2025.
The model's supply shock calculation reflects AI's growing role in parsing market microstructure across fragmented global exchanges. XRP trades on dozens of platforms from Binance to Upbit, each with varying liquidity and spreads—data complexity that challenges traditional analysis tools.
ChatGPT's $6-8 range acknowledges this uncertainty rather than offering point estimates. The probabilistic approach mirrors risk assessment methods at central banks and sovereign wealth funds, where scenario planning increasingly incorporates machine learning models.
The forecast's accuracy matters less than what it demonstrates: language models can now process regulatory variables, institutional capital flows, and supply-demand dynamics across multiple jurisdictions. Whether XRP reaches these targets depends on SEC ETF approvals, institutional allocations worldwide, and retail sentiment across markets from Seoul to São Paulo.
